WVIAC Sunday Baseball Review

Davis & Elkins 4, West Virginia Wesleyan 2

BUCKHANNON, W. Va. – The Wesleyan baseball team finished out its three game series with Davis and Elkins this afternoon with a 4-2 defeat in ten innings. The Bobcats and Senators also played an extra inning contest in game two of Saturday’s doubleheader.

Wesleyan nabbed the first lead of the game in the bottom of the second as a Zach Miller groundout allowed Aaron Wiegel to cross the plate.

The Senators answered right back, though, tying the game win a run in the top of the third.

The game remained 1-1 until the top of the 10th when Davis and Elkins capitalized off of Bobcat errors to put three runs on the board.

Wesleyan attempted to regain control in the bottom of the 10th, but only managed one run by Gary Williams who scored off a single by Gene Franks.

Taking the loss on the mound for the Bobcats was Nathan Gainer in 2.0 innings of relief.

Starting the game on the mound for Wesleyan was Cy Mozingo. Pitching 8.0 innings, Mozingo tallied 11 strikeouts and one earned run.

The Bobcats are next in action at home on Tuesday, May 3rd against Shepherd. First pitch for the doubleheader is scheduled for 1:00 p.m.

Shepherd 9, Pitt-Johnstown 6

JOHNSTOWN, Pa. – Senior outfielder Derek Gunsell (Durand, MI/Mott CC) belted a solo homer and junior first baseman Nathan Minnich (Waynesboro, PA/Waynesboro Area) added a two-run blast in the top of the 11th inning to lift Shepherd University to a 9-6 victory over Pitt-Johnstown in WVIAC baseball action at Point Stadium on Sunday.

The Rams plated a pair of runs in the eighth and one in the ninth to force extra innings.

Freshman first baseman Morgan Lautz (Bel Air, MD/Mt. St Joseph) and freshman outfielder Dillon Berger (Lansdowne, VA/Stonebridge) each had RBI-doubles in the eighth and freshman designated hitter Nick Impellizzeri (Reston, VA/Herndon) rapped an RBI-single in the ninth.

Minnich went 3-for-6 with three runs batted in as he added a solo homer and now has 13 round-trippers on the season.

Lautz, Berger, and senior second baseman Val Arduini (Clifton, VA/Okaloosa Walton CC) each had a pair of hits for the Rams.

Gunsell scored twice and drove in a pair of runs.

Zach Martin and Drew Shaulis each had three hits to lead Pitt-Johnstown.

Junior reliever Andrew Gallant (Oak Ridge, NJ/Jefferson Twp.)  (4.0 IP, 5 Ks, 1 BB) gained the win to improve to 2-5. Jon Moore (3.1 IP, 4 Ks, 2 BB) took the loss for UPJ to fall to 1-4.

Shepherd improves to 13-20 overall, 8-16 in WVIAC play, while Pitt-Johnstown falls to 17-23, 13-13. The Rams return to action on Tuesday when they travel to West Virginia Wesleyan for a 1 p.m. doubleheader.
